Output bbcc6dd4d13081e61217aed6294f4cb5f31518b601f7563521c83758953cb609:3

value
249575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d666e6e1e98e376357f1a2f647109e05a2d4aafb OP_EQUAL
address
3MEfoLtdtsYQhrpUjzad8KMYCCjNAsbwJM
transaction
bbcc6dd4d13081e61217aed6294f4cb5f31518b601f7563521c83758953cb609
spent
true